Substantial work has been devoted to characterizing student andexpert problem-solving in physics [5-11] and engineering [12-14], but there are almost noagreed-upon measures of problem solving [8]. If we are to teach undergraduate students to solvecomplex, real-world problems we must be able to measure how well they are learning thenecessary skills. In this work, we describe the testing of a new assessment to measuredimensions of problem-solving in undergraduate chemical engineering courses.Much of the empirical work in problem-solving has focused on differences between experts

The answer would be affirmative if the principles were used in the same way.Unfortunately, the applications (and therefore the necessary skills) have changedradically.The inexorable increase in semiconductor packing density has several importantconsequences. The first is that the cost of a gate or a memory cell is now measured innano-$ 7. True, they come millions or even billions on a chip but these are today’sbuilding blocks. The second feature is that chip fabrication and the associated boardassembly process are sufficiently reliable to allow millions of samples to be made withvery few failures.
